USAID Research Support Program


Summary: The Policy and Global Affairs (PGA) Division of the U.S. National Research Council (NRC) provides technical and administrative support to the U.S.-Israel Research Programs of the U.S. Agency for International Development (USAID). Through two international collaborative research programs, the U.S.-Israel Cooperative Development Research (CDR) Program and the Middle East Regional Cooperation (MERC) Program, USAID provides research grants to scientists for the application of advanced scientific techniques and innovative technologies to important problems in USAID-targeted areas of the world, while helping to strengthening international scientific capacity. MERC grants provide for collaboration between Israeli and Arab scientists. CDR grants are directed towards Israeli cooperation with developing-country scientists, with a separate component for collaboration with the Central Asian Republics (CAR). PGA staff provides USAID with assistance in securing peer-review of research proposals and in the technical monitoring of grants for CDR and MERC. All program and funding decisions are made by USAID.
